--- title: AI编程智能体2026:从"代码助手"到"自主工程师"的范式跃迁 index_img: /img/cover61.png date: 2026-05-18 22:00:00 sticky: true categories: - Tech前沿 tags: - AI前沿 --- ## 背景与概述 2026年5月,GitHub Trending榜单出现了近半年来最"炸裂"的景象——**AI编程智能体(AI Coding Agents)赛道全面霸榜**。从Claude Code到Aider,从Cursor到开源社区涌现的一批新工具,AI不再只是"帮你写代码的副驾驶",而是正在成为能自主理解需求、规划架构、编写并调试整个项目的"初级工程师"。 此前我们已报道过OpenAI GPT-5.4的原生电脑操控能力和Claude Opus 4的多模态突破(见往期文章),但今天我们将聚焦一个同样深刻却被部分读者忽略的趋势:**当AI从对话窗口走进终端、从建议者变为执行者时,软件工程的基础设施正在被彻底重构。** --- ## 核心亮点:2026年AI编程智能体的四大里程碑 ### 1. Claude Code正式成为开发者标配 Anthropic的官方CLI工具 **Claude Code** 在2026年上半年完成了从预览到稳定版的全流程。它允许开发者在终端中直接与Claude交互,完成代码编写、调试、重构等全流程任务。与传统的ChatGPT-style对话不同,Claude Code具备完整的文件系统访问能力、命令执行权限和Git集成。 ```bash # 安装与使用示例 claude "将auth中间件从JWT迁移到OAuth2.0,更新所有相关API端点和测试" ``` 运行后,Claude Code会自主读取项目代码、规划修改方案、执行编辑并跑通测试——**全程无需人工干预**。据菜鸟教程和多个开发者社区反馈,其平均任务完成时间约为传统手工编码的1/3至1/5。 ### 2. Aider 与开源生态的全面崛起 如果说Claude Code代表了闭源商业工具的天花板,那么 **Aider** 等开源项目则展示了AI编程智能体的另一个发展方向:**透明、可审计、可定制**。 Aider的核心优势在于: - **完全本地化运行**,代码数据无需上传至第三方服务器 - **支持多种后端模型切换**(Claude GPT、Gemini、开源Qwen等) - **MCP协议原生支持**,可通过Model Context Protocol接入任意外部工具链 - **增量式commit策略**,每次修改自动生成有意义的Git提交 ### 3. GitHub Skills生态:让AI Agent具备"专业技能" 这是2026年5月GitHub Trending上最引人注目的变化。多个AI编程Agent项目通过**Skills机制**(技能插件系统)实现了周增星破万的惊人增长。这些Skills让AI Agent能够: - 理解特定技术栈的架构规范 - 调用外部API和数据库进行数据验证 - 执行复杂的代码审查与重构流程 正如知乎上的分析文章所述:"GitHub Trending榜单上,AI Agent Skills生态几乎霸榜,多个项目周增星破万。"这一趋势表明:**AI编程的智能性正在从通用推理能力转向特定领域专业化。** ### 4. Vibe Coding向MCP执行范式的演进 早期的Vibe Coding(随意指令式编程)存在一个根本问题:AI生成代码的正确性和安全性无法保证。2026年的新范式是 **MCP-driven Autonomous Execution**——通过Model Context Protocol,AI Agent在明确的安全边界内自主规划并执行任务: | 阶段 | Vibe Coding | MCP驱动Agent | |------|------------|-------------| | 指令方式 | 自然语言随意描述 | 结构化任务定义 | | 安全边界 | 无/有限 | 沙箱隔离 + 权限分级 | | 可审计性 | 黑盒 | 完整commit历史+日志 | | 复杂项目支持 | 单文件为主 | 跨仓库多模块 | --- ## 深度分析:为什么是现在? ### 1. 大模型推理能力的质变 Claude Opus 4和GPT-5系列在代码理解上已经超越了简单的语法补全,进入了**架构级推理**阶段。这意味着AI不再只能回答"这段代码是什么意思",而是能回答"这个项目应该怎么重构"。 以Claude Code为例,它能: - 读取整个项目的依赖树并理解模块间关系 - 识别潜在的安全漏洞(如SQL注入、XSS) - 提出并执行最优的重构方案 ### 2. Agent架构的成熟 过去AI编程工具的最大瓶颈是**上下文窗口有限**。当项目规模达到数万行代码时,传统的"将整个文件塞进prompt"的方式彻底失效。2026年成熟的Agent框架(如LangChain、LlamaIndex的Agent变体)通过以下方案解决了这一问题: ``` 用户需求 → Agent Planner (拆解任务) → Code Retriever (按需加载相关代码) → LLM推理 (生成修改方案) → Diff Applied → Test Runner (自动验证) → Feedback Loop → 迭代修正 ``` 这个流程的关键在于 **Code Retriever**——它使用向量索引在项目中精准定位需要修改的相关代码片段,而非暴力全量注入。这使得AI能够处理百万行级别的大型项目。 ### 3. MCP协议成为新基础设施 2026年5月,**Model Context Protocol (MCP)** 正在迅速成为AI Agent的标准通信协议。它类似于HTTP之于Web——让不同模型、不同工具的Agent能够互操作。一个用Claude训练的编码Agent可以通过MCP调用基于GPT的测试生成工具,再通过另一个MCP服务提交代码到Git仓库。**协议的标准化是生态爆发的先决条件。** --- ## 影响与展望 ### 对开发者社区的影响 **短期**(6-12个月):AI编程智能体将重塑初级开发者的工作模式。大量重复性工作(CRUD、测试编写、Bug修复)将被自动化工具接管,开发者需要更多聚焦于架构设计和技术选型。 **中期**(1-3年):"一人公司"成为可能。一个熟练使用AI编码Agent的开发者,配合MCP生态中的专业工具链,足以独立完成过去需要一个10人团队才能完成的项目。 **长期**(3-5年):软件工程行业将出现新的分工——不再是"程序员 vs 非程序员",而是 **"AI编排者 vs AI消费者"** 的区别。前者懂得如何设计Agent工作流、配置MCP连接、编写高质量的Skills;后者只是被动地使用最终产品。 ### 风险与挑战 1. **代码质量与安全隐患**:AI生成的代码可能包含逻辑错误或安全漏洞,尤其在边界条件处理上 2. **技术债的隐性积累**:快速生成但理解不足的代码将成为"定时炸弹" 3. **开发者技能退化**:过度依赖可能导致基础编码能力丧失 4. **开源许可证风险**:AI训练数据的版权和衍生代码的归属问题仍需法律界定 ### 结语 2026年5月的GitHub Trending榜单,不仅仅是一份流行度排行榜——它是一封来自未来的邀请函。**AI编程智能体正在从"工具"进化为"伙伴",而这场进化的速度远超所有人的预期。** 无论你是资深开发者还是技术决策者,现在正是理解并拥抱这一变革的最佳时机。因为当AI从建议者变为执行者时,**代码的写作方式在变,但软件工程的核心原则从未改变:清晰、可靠、可维护。** > *参考资料:知乎《2026年5月GitHub趋势深度盘点》、菜鸟教程Claude Code安装指南、必应AI日报、各项目官方文档*